Every year, Tri-County Michigan H.O.G. Chapter #2250 presents a Teddy Bear Run. The purpose of the run is to put a smile on the face of a child at Covenant HealthCare. At least 1,000 children benefit from the Teddy Bear Run every year with thousands of teddy bears donated over the past 13 years. 2019 is their 14th run, and they are excited to once again come to the rescue of sick or injured children.

The run is a motorcycle event open to the public and beganat Great Lakes Harley Davidson located at 3850 South Huron Road nearBay City, on Saturday. The ride is police patrolled and traffic directed at major intersections with over 200 motorcycles adorned with teddy bears and other stuffed animals. This year the event  included a new route which captures 50 scenic miles and arrived at Covenant at 4 pm for the Teddy Bear presentation to the hospital. Tri-County Michigan H.O.G. Chapter #2250 and Great Lakes Harley-Davidson are the largest stuffed animal donors to Covenant Kids. This ride provides enough teddy bears and stuffed animals to Covenant Kids for an entire year.
